Output 8ec66f051817123bab3aab7a1e38812282dee526d311f0cf14451b19ac3ad72e:2

value
87267973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434d8316fa60c8defe063203e9a28e9373238fee OP_EQUAL
address
ME32Mv55Zp3KLDGakx4x3cyxkJqPypGrhf
transaction
8ec66f051817123bab3aab7a1e38812282dee526d311f0cf14451b19ac3ad72e
spent
true